    Isidor Gunsberg vs Jose Raul Capablanca
    St. Petersburg (1914), St. Petersburg RUE, rd 10, May-05
    King's Gambit: Accepted. Bishop's Gambit Bogoljubow Variation (C33)
    1. e4 e5 2. f4 ef4 3. Bc4 Nf6 4. Nc3 Bb4 5. e5 d5 6. Bb3 Ne4 7. Nf3 c6 8. Qe2 Bc3 9. dc3 g5 10. Nd2 Bf5 11. Ne4 Be4 12. Bd2 Nd7 13. c4 Qe7 14. cd5 cd5 15. Bc3 O-O-O 16. e6 Nf6 17. ef7 Qf7 18. O-O-O Rhe8 19. h4 h6 20. hg5 hg5 21. Rh6 Re6 22. Bf6 Rf6 23. Qg4 Rf5 24. Rdh1 f3 25. Rh7 fg2 26. R1h6 g1Q

    The St Petersburg Tournament of 1914 featured the joint winners of the 1914 All Russian Championship and players who had won at least one major tournament. There were the veterans Blackburne and Gunsberg, established masters such as Tarrasch, Bernstein, Janowski, Nimzowitsch, Alekhine and Marshall as well as the World Champion Lasker and his two most prominent rivals, Rubinstein and Capablanca.
    The tournament was divided into two sections. The first stage from the 21st April to the 6th of May was an all-play-all event with the first five finishers proceeding into the second stage which ran from the 10th to the 22nd of May. This second stage was a double round all-play-all with the scores from the preliminaries being carried over to the final.
    Prizes amounted to 1200, 800, 500, 300 and 200 Rubles. Each non-prizewinner received 20 Rubles for every game won and 10 Rubles for every drawn game.
    A brilliancy prize was being considered for Nimzowitsch vs Tarrasch, 1914 after the 5th round's finish, but more than 2 rounds later, it was awarded a 2nd brilliancy prize as the runner-up to the Capablanca vs O Bernstein, 1914 coup.
    The main source for this collection was the St. Petersburg 1914 International Chess Tournament book by Dr Siegbert Tarrasch. ISBN 0-939433-17-6.
